FDA clears CoreLink’s CentraFix midline fixation system

December 2, 2021 By Sean Whooley

CoreLink announced today that it won FDA 510(k) clearance for and commercially launched its CentraFix midline fixation system. St. Louis-based CoreLink designed CentraFix as a posterior thoracolumbar pedicle screw for less invasive spinal fixation, often used with a medial-to-lateral approach known as cortical bone trajectory (CBT). CoreLink wins FDA clearance for standalone cervical spine system

June 30, 2020 By Sean Whooley

CoreLink announced today that it received FDA 510(k) clearance for its F3D-C2 standalone cervical system for ACDF procedures. The F3D-C2 standalone cervical device eliminates the need for a supplemental fixation plate to make ACDF (anterior cervical discectomy and fusion) procedures easier to complete and a faster process overall. CoreLink touts 5,000 ortho implants using 3D printed technology

January 17, 2020 By Sean Whooley

CoreLink announced that it completed the implantation of more than 5,000 3D printed orthopedic devices using its proprietary Mimetic Metal technology. The St. Louis–based company went over the 5,000-implant threshold in November 2019, just over two years on from the first implantation with the F3D anterior cervical interbody in June 2017. CoreLink buys Expanding Orthopedics and its expanding spinal fusion systems

June 5, 2018 By Chris Newmarker

Spinal implant systems maker CoreLink (St. Louis) said today that it has acquired the privately held Israeli medical device company Expanding Orthopedics and its FDA-cleared expanding and articulating FLXfit and FLXfit 15 titanium transforaminal lumbar interbody fusion systems.
